A popular Japanese dessert, Mochi balls are a sweet pounded rice dough wrapped around a ball of ice cream, making a bite-sized frozen treat. And there seems to be a never-ending list of flavours, including matcha green tea, strawberry, chocolate, mango, black sesame, vanilla and coffee.

To rekindle our love of the mochi balls this summer, Aldi's launched two flavours of the sweet treat in-store on 14 March. The flavours are caramel and cheesecake, but currently it's only the caramel flavour available online at the moment. And both have a surprise twist we haven’t yet seen before from this range.

Wao caramel mochi balls are the first addition to the range, combining a smooth caramel ice cream with a gooey sauce centre, because who doesn’t love a good dollop of caramel? And quite excitingly, these are already available to shop online as well as in-store.

The second new addition is the Wao cheesecake mochi balls, a sweet and creamy vanilla ice cream with a gooey strawberry sauce centre. And although we haven’t yet gotten to taste one of these, it looks like these will have a biscuity crumb coat too.

Aldi recommend that you take all mochi balls out of the freezer two to three minutes before eating them to make sure you get that chewy mochi texture they’re known for, so be sure to bear this in mind before tucking in.
